People and Planet

People and Planet is the largest student network in Britain which campaigns for alleviation of world poverty, better human rights and protecting the environment. Groups are based at universities and colleges and run by students. The site has full details about campaigns and how to get involved. Job vacancies are sometimes listed.

Guernsey Bar

The Website of the Guernsey Bar provides information about Guernsey law and advocates. It has contact details for members and a directory of Guernsey law firms, together with information about the role of an advocate and a history of the Guernsey Bar. There is also advice on instructing an advocate, getting legal aid and making a complaint. The guidance on Guernsey law covers civil proceedings, criminal proceedings and family proceedings. Full-text legislation and links to legislation are also given.

Air Safety Support International

The website of the Air Safety Support International (ASSI) is an online information resource that aims to provide information about the organisation's role and activities within the framework of civil aviation regulation in the UK Overseas Territories (OTs). As a subsidiary company of the UK Civil Aviation Authority, ASSI's role is to assist and support existing civil aviation authorities in their safety regulation in these territories. A page with a listing of the OTs is provided with links to their websites.

Northern Ireland Social Security and Child Support Commissioners' Decisions

A BAILII database containing decisions of the Northern Ireland Social Security and Child Support Commissioners'. These are members of the judiciary who hear appeals on points of law relating to benefits and child support from Appeal Tribunals under the Social Security and Child Support legislation.The database contains decisions from 1988 onwards to date. Cases are arranged chronologically by year and using the Commissioners' own numbering system which is explained on the site. The system also offers a comprehensive search facility and Recent Cases listing.

Industrial Tribunals and Fair Employment Tribunal

Official Website of the Northern Ireland Industrial Tribunals and Fair Employment Tribunal. These are independent judicial bodies that deal with complaints brought under various employment protection legislation. The site provides a selection of FAQs with information on applying to a tribunal and covering issues such as what the hearing involves, representation and expenses. There is also information on the types of complaints that are heard by the tribunals and application forms which can be downloaded from the site.

Transitional Justice Institute

Website of the Transitional Justice Institute, a research centre based at the University of Ulster. Transitional justice is defined on the site as being the "interim legal arrangements which come to the fore as states enter into transition from violent conflict to peace and democracy". Profiles are given of staff at the Institute along with details of their publications and links to full-text articles where available. Details are given of forthcoming events and research projects taking place at the Institute. A Peace Agreements Database is made freely available to browse or search.
